Trade-offs between biodiversity conservation, ecosystem service provision and economic development in tropical forests

Period: 2009 - current

Coordinator: Toby Alan Gardner

Members: Silvio Frosini de Barros Ferraz

Funding: CNPq - Financial aid / The Nature Conservancy do Brasil - Financial aid

The overall aim of this project is to develop a unique three-dimensional spatial assessment of the economic-biodiversity-ecosystem service value of a representative set of multiple-use forest landscapes that characterize the deforestation zone of the Brazilian Amazon.
